The Lookout (Twitter)

Two Black Sea Fleet ships, the seagoing tug Sergey Balk and the small tanker Vice Admiral Paromov are tracking south in the Baltic.

Both were deployed to the Med on Feb 24, last year.

The Sergey Balk arrives in the Baltic in October and the Paromov in August.

The Lookout (Twitter)

The Vice Admiral Paromov arrived in Kronstadt along with the Black Sea Fleet Moma-class AGI Kildin.
